Abstract:A simple, rapid and sensitive method for methyl-Beta-cyclodextrin determination by employing Coomassie Brilliant Blue G-250 binding to methyl-Beta-cyclodextrin is described. The binding of the dye to methyl-Beta-cyclodextrin causes a shift in the absorption maximum of the dye from 465 to 637 nM, and the increase of the absorption at 637 nM can be monitored by spectrum photometer. The binding process virtually completes within approximately 5 minutes and the color stability can last at least for 1 hour. This assay is very reproducible, simple, sensitive, and may provide extensive application possibilities in research of biological membranes and drug dynamics.
